2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,11,12,13-dodecahydro-3-methyl-1H-cyclopent-1-ylcyclododecen-1-one, also known as Iso E Super, is a synthetic fragrance compound that is widely used in the perfumery industry. It is a clear, colorless liquid with a faint woody, cedar-like odor. 2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,11,12,13-dodecahydro-3-methyl-1H-cyclopent-1-ylcyclododecen-1-one is known for its subtle and long-lasting scent, making it an ideal fixative in perfumes to enhance the longevity and diffusion of other fragrant ingredients. Its synthetic nature, coupled with its low skin irritation and environmental friendliness, has made Iso E Super a popular choice for sensitive individuals and a safe ingredient in various personal care products.

56975-51-0 Usage

Uses

Used in Perfumery Industry:
Iso E Super is used as a fixative in perfumes for its ability to enhance the longevity and diffusion of other fragrant ingredients. Its subtle and long-lasting scent contributes to the overall aroma profile of the perfume, providing a woody, cedar-like undertone.
Used in Personal Care Products:
Iso E Super is used in various personal care products due to its low skin irritation and environmental friendliness. Its properties make it a safe ingredient for sensitive individuals, ensuring minimal adverse reactions while providing a pleasant scent.
Used as a Fragrance Ingredient:
Iso E Super is used as a fragrance ingredient in a wide range of products, including candles, air fresheners, and cleaning products. Its long-lasting scent and compatibility with other fragrances make it a versatile addition to these products, enhancing their overall aroma and appeal.

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 56975-51-0 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 5,6,9,7 and 5 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 5 and 1 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 56975-51:
(7*5)+(6*6)+(5*9)+(4*7)+(3*5)+(2*5)+(1*1)=170
170 % 10 = 0
So 56975-51-0 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Three-Carbon Annelations. Regiocontrolled Reactivity of Trimethylsilyl- and Ethoxyethyl-Protected Cyanohydrins. Versatile Homoenolate and Acyl Anion Equivalents

Jacobson, Richard M.,Lahm, George P.,Clader, John W.

, p. 395 - 405 (2007/10/02)

The trimethylsilyl- (2) and ethoxyethyl- (4) protected cyanohydrins of α,β-unsaturated aldehydes are utilized as three-carbon annelation reagents.Metalated reagent 2 displays exclusive α reactivity with aldehydes and ketones at -78 deg C.Metalated reagent 4 displays exclusive α reactivity at -78 deg C and exclusive γ reactivity at 0 deg C.Reagent 4 thus allows for complete regiocontrol in its addition to aldehydes and ketones which permits selective addition of either a homoenolate or an acyl anion equivalent.Metalation of the α product 11 at -78 deg C with subsequent warming to 0 deg C produces exclusively the γ product, confirming the reversible nature of the addition to the carbonyl.The derived α '-trimethylsiloxy enones 17 (R3=Me3Si), α '-hydroxy enones 17 (R3=H), α '-acetoxyenones 17 (R3=Ac), and γ-lactones 10 are useful cyclopentenone precursors.Treatment of 17 with p-TsOH in toluene at reflux produces cyclopentenones.The reaction proceeds via the postulated intermediacy of a pentadienyl cation 15 which undergoes in situ electrocyclic ring closure.

Silanes in Organic Synthesis. 8. Preparation of Vinylsilanes from Ketones and Their Regiospecific Cyclopentenone Annulation

Paquette, Leo A.,Fristad, William E.,Dime, David S.,Bailey, Thomas R.

, p. 3017 - 3028 (2007/10/02)

A general method is described for the formation of vinylsilanes from ketones.Thus, conversion to the benzene- or p-toluenesulfonylhydrazone and sequential treatment with n-butyllithium and chlorotrimethylsilane in anhydrous tetramethylethylenediamine proceeds regiospecifically to afford the less substituted vinylsilane (in unsymmetrical cases).Friedel-Crafts acylation with acryloyl chlorides and aluminium chloride and subsequent Nazarov cyclization with Lewis acid catalysis results in cyclopentenone annulation.Numerous examples that reveal the scope of this processare described.Due to accompanying polymerization, annulation with acryloyl chloride itself is least efficient.This complication can, however, be averted through use of β-chloropropionyl chloride and dehydrochlorination with 1,5-diazabicycloundec-5-ene prior to ring closure.
